[SCM] ktp-text-ui packaging branch, master, updated. debian/15.12.1-1-1918-gdf4b0ec

Maximiliano Curia maxy at moszumanska.debian.org
Sat May 28 00:23:52 UTC 2016


Gitweb-URL: http://git.debian.org/?p=pkg-kde/applications/ktp-text-ui.git;a=commitdiff;h=85d1ea3

The following commit has been merged in the master branch:
commit 85d1ea32df6ec9cdd1dd685ee9d2a240c1affa8e
Merge: bb9aae22eed7f7445c7c6aeb5440d143bb02b3b4 590775b2c97dd6a4007d9d97a05a93e4b93e5e31
Author: Martin Klapetek <martin.klapetek at gmail.com>
Date:   Thu Apr 18 15:17:44 2013 +0200

    Merge branch 'kde-telepathy-0.6'

 CMakeLists.txt                                      |  2 +-
 app/chat-window.cpp                                 |  7 ++++---
 app/chat-window.h                                   |  2 +-
 app/telepathy-chat-ui.cpp                           |  2 +-
 .../Contents/Resources/main.css                     |  1 +
 lib/logmanager.cpp                                  | 10 ++++++++++
 logviewer/message-view.cpp                          | 21 +++++++++++++++++++--
 7 files changed, 37 insertions(+), 8 deletions(-)

diff --cc logviewer/message-view.cpp
index a50fe19,a86c3ff..96ad846
--- a/logviewer/message-view.cpp
+++ b/logviewer/message-view.cpp
@@@ -111,13 -115,47 +115,17 @@@ void MessageView::processStoredEvents(
          message.setService(m_account->serviceName());
          message.setTime(QDateTime(m_prev));
  
 -        addStatusMessage(message);
 +        addAdiumStatusMessage(message);
      }
  
+     // See https://bugs.kde.org/show_bug.cgi?id=317866
+     // Uses the operator< overload above
+     qSort(m_events);
+ 
      while (!m_events.isEmpty()) {
 -
          const Tpl::TextEventPtr textEvent(m_events.takeFirst().staticCast<Tpl::TextEvent>());
 -
 -        AdiumThemeMessageInfo::MessageType type;
 -        QString iconPath;
 -
 -        if(textEvent->sender()->identifier() == m_account->normalizedName()) {
 -            type = AdiumThemeMessageInfo::HistoryLocalToRemote;
 -            iconPath = m_accountAvatar;
 -        } else {
 -            type = AdiumThemeMessageInfo::HistoryRemoteToLocal;
 -            /* FIXME Add support for avatars in MUCs */
 -            if (m_entity->entityType() == Tpl::EntityTypeContact) {
 -                if (m_contact) {
 -                    iconPath = m_contact->avatarData().fileName;
 -                }
 -            }
 -        }
 -
 -        AdiumThemeContentInfo message(type);
 -        message.setMessage(KTp::MessageProcessor::instance()->processIncomingMessage(textEvent, m_account, Tp::TextChannelPtr()).finalizedMessage());
 -        message.setService(m_account->serviceName());
 -        message.setSenderDisplayName(textEvent->sender()->alias());
 -        message.setSenderScreenName(textEvent->sender()->identifier());
 -        message.setTime(textEvent->timestamp());
 -        message.setUserIconPath(iconPath);
 -
 -        kDebug()    << textEvent->timestamp()
 -                    << "from" << textEvent->sender()->identifier()
 -                    << "to" << textEvent->receiver()->identifier()
 -                    << textEvent->message();
 -
 -        addContentMessage(message);
 +        KTp::Message message = KTp::MessageProcessor::instance()->processIncomingMessage(textEvent, m_account, Tp::TextChannelPtr());
 +        addMessage(message);
      }
  
      if (m_next.isValid()) {

-- 
ktp-text-ui packaging



More information about the pkg-kde-commits mailing list